The pressure amplitudes in the mouse brain will certainly be somewhat lower because of absorption and defocusing by the skull. A recent research study in rats reported a stress transmission price of 82% at a frequency of 1.5 MHz33. Using the 82% transmission rate, the in-situ peak unfavorable pressures in the present research study would be about 11 MPa. In a summary record on cavitation impacts, cavitational thresholds in the brain were recognized as 12.0 MPa at 0.66 MHz (sheep model), 10.4 MPa at 0.94 MHz (bunny), and 13.6 MPa at 1.72 MHz (rabbit) 34. In today research entailing the computer mouse brain, attenuation along the brief propagation path is marginal, and positive interference adhering to representation of the head base may have caused stress higher than 11 MPa.
